Sony Reportedly Pauses PSVR 2 Production Due to Low Sales

Sony has reportedly paused production of PSVR 2, as it looks to clear its backlog of inventory first before resuming. According to a Bloomberg report, PSVR 2 sales have “slowed progressively” since its February 2023 launch. ‘Horizon Call of the Mountain’ Promises “multiple paths”, New Clips Captured on PSVR 2
Horizon Call of the Mountain, an exclusive title headed to PSVR 2, got its first gameplay trailer earlier this month which suggested VR’s first Horizon series game would be more than just an ‘experience’.
